Infrared AstronomyReinhard Genzel studies infrared- and submillimetre astronomy. He was the first researcher to track the motions of stars at the centre of the Milky Way and show that they were orbiting a very massive object, probably a black hole[http://adsabs.harvard.edu/cgi-bin/bib_query?1996Natur.383..415E].
